Fence Demolition Services
Fence demolition involves the careful removal and disposal of existing fencing structures, whether they are made of wood, vinyl, chain-link, or other materials. The process typically includes dismantling the fence, breaking down any supporting posts, and clearing the debris from the property. Skilled service providers utilize specialized tools and techniques to ensure that the demolition is performed efficiently and safely, minimizing disruption to the surrounding landscape or structures.
This service addresses several common property concerns. Over time, fences may become damaged, outdated, or no longer serve their intended purpose. Fence demolition allows property owners to replace old or deteriorating fencing with new installations or to clear space for other landscaping or construction projects. Removing fences can also improve visibility, security, or access around a property, particularly when fences are no longer functional or are obstructive.

The overview below groups typical Fence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Pittstown, NJ.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Labor Costs - Demolition labor charges typically range from $300 to $1,200 depending on fence size and complexity. Larger or more intricate fences may incur higher labor fees.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ific project details.
Disposal Fees - Disposal costs for fence debris usually fall between $100 and $400. These fees depend on the volume of material and local disposal regulations. Some contractors include disposal in their overall project estimates.
Equipment and Tools - Equipment rental or usage fees may add $50 to $200 to the total cost. This includes tools like jackhammers, saws, and dumpsters needed for efficient demolition. Costs vary based on project scope and duration.
Additional Expenses - Extra costs such as permits or site preparation can range from $50 to $300. These expenses depend on local regulations and the condition of the fence and surrounding area. Contractors can advise on potential additional charges.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in fence demolition? Fence demolition typically includes removing existing fencing materials, such as wood, vinyl, or chain-link, and disposing of the debris safely and responsibly.
How long does fence demolition usually take? The duration depends on the size and type of the fence, but most projects can be completed within a day or two by local contractors.
Are there permits required for fence demolition? Permit requirements vary by location; contacting local authorities or contractors can provide guidance on necessary approvals.
Can existing fence posts be reused after demolition? Reusing fence posts depends on their condition; a professional can assess whether they are salvageable for future use.
